Comprehending Category B Driving License
A Category B driving license, typically described as a vehicle driving license, is an authorization that allows the holder to drive cars such as automobiles, little vans, and small trucks. This classification is among the most typical and important licenses for daily driving requirements. It is particularly important for people who need to commute to work, run errands, or travel for leisure.
Eligibility Requirements
Before you can request a Category B driving license, you need to satisfy certain eligibility requirements. These requirements may differ slightly depending upon the nation or area, however normally include:
Age: Most countries require candidates to be at least 17 years old to look for a student’s license and 18 years of ages to acquire a full license.Residency: You need to be a resident of the nation or area where you are obtaining the license.Medical Fitness: You need to be in health and meet the minimum vision requirements. Some nations might need a medical evaluation to verify your physical fitness to drive.Learner’s Permit: In numerous places, you require to hold a student’s license for a particular duration before you can take the useful driving test.Actions to Obtain a Category B Driving License
Make an application for a Learner’s Permit
Documentation: Gather the required documents, such as your recognition, proof of address, and a medical certificate if required.Application: Fill out the application and send it to the appropriate authority, such as the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) or the Driver and Vehicle Licensing Agency (DVLA).Theory Test: Pass the theory test, which typically covers road guidelines, traffic indications, and safe driving practices.
Practice Driving
Supervised Driving: Practice driving under the supervision of a certified driver who is at least 21 years of ages and has held a complete license for a minimum of 3 years.Driving Lessons: Consider taking professional driving lessons to improve your skills and confidence. Lots of driving schools provide structured programs that cover all aspects of safe driving.
Take the Practical Driving Test
Test Preparation: Familiarize yourself with the test path and practice the required maneuvers, such as parallel parking, turning, and Prawa Jazdy Za Granicę emergency stops.Test Day: Arrive on time with the needed files, such as your student’s permit, identification, and the lorry you will be using for the test.Test Evaluation: The examiner will evaluate your ability to drive safely and follow traffic rules. You may be asked to perform particular maneuvers and show your understanding of roadway signs and signals.
Get the Full License
Pass the Test: If you pass the useful driving test, you will be issued a provisionary complete license.License Validity: The credibility duration of the license may differ, but it is usually legitimate for numerous years before it needs to be renewed.Extra ConsiderationsInsurance coverage: Ensure that you have valid vehicle insurance coverage before you begin driving. A lot of countries require motorists to have at least third-party liability insurance.Lorry Requirements: Make sure the car you are using for the test is roadworthy and satisfies all legal requirements, such as having a legitimate MOT certificate (in the UK) or passing a car inspection (in other nations).Driving Restrictions: Some countries may impose limitations on brand-new motorists, such as a curfew or a limit on the number of travelers they can carry. Q: What is the minimum age to make an application for a Category B driving license?A: The minimum age to obtain a student’s license is normally 17 years of ages, and the minimum age to acquire a complete Category B driving license is 18 years of ages. However, this can differ by nation.

Q: What documents do I need to apply for a student’s license?A: You will generally require to supply your identification, proof of address, and a medical certificate if needed. Talk to your local DMV or DVLA for a complete list of needed documents.

Q: How long do I need to hold a student’s permit before taking the practical test?A: The required holding period for a student’s authorization varies by nation. In some locations, you may need to hold the license for at least 6 months before taking the dry run.

Q: Can I take the practical driving test in my own automobile?A: Yes, you can usually take the practical test in your own automobile, provided it fulfills all legal requirements and remains in great condition. Nevertheless, it must be guaranteed, and you should have the owner’s approval.

Q: What happens if I fail the useful driving test?A: If you fail the test, you can retake it after a specific duration, which differs by country. It is a good idea to take extra driving lessons to improve your skills before retaking the test.

Q: How long is a Category B driving license valid?A: The validity period of a Category B driving license differs by nation, but it is generally legitimate for a number of years before it needs to be restored. Examine with your local DMV or DVLA for specific details.
